Pat Summitt, who passed away in 2016 after battling early-onset Alzheimer’s disease, is widely regarded as one of the greatest basketball coaches of all time. Over her 38-year tenure at Tennessee, she transformed the Lady Volunteers into a dominant force in women’s college basketball, accumulating over 1,000 career victories—the most by any NCAA Division I basketball coach at the time of her retirement in 2012. Summitt’s unparalleled success on the court, combined with her fierce leadership and dedication to her players, cemented her legacy as an icon of the game.

In 2011, Summitt made the courageous decision to publicly disclose her Alzheimer’s diagnosis, a move that stunned the sports world. Despite the early stages of the disease, she continued to coach for another season, demonstrating an unmatched level of determination and strength. Her ability to manage her career and family life while battling a debilitating condition became a testament to her unwavering commitment to her team and to the sport she loved.
